List of the Top Mississippi Online Psychology Programs
1. Mississippi State University
Mississippi State University in Starkville is a large public research university that offers an online Bachelor of Science degree in psychology identical to the one taught on campus.
It requires 124 credits to graduate. Students can transfer up to 62 credits. The cost per credit is $385.50 plus fees for residents and non-residents.
Examples of core courses include:
- social psychology
- cognitive psychology
- biological psychology
- developmental psychology
Students prepare for career fields such as:
- case management
- community mental health
- social work
2. Belhaven University
Belhaven University in Jackson is a small private Christian liberal arts institution that offers an online Bachelor of Arts in applied psychology program.
It is one of the few online psychology colleges in Mississippi that teaches students from a Christian worldview. The program requires 124 total credits and costs $425 per credit plus fees.
In addition, active-duty military members receive a discounted rate of $250 per credit plus fees. Military spouses, veterans, and first responders pay $340 plus fees.
Students choose from three concentrations:
- Christian ministries
- criminal justice
- human services
3. Blue Mountain Christian University
Blue Mountain Christian University (formerly Blue Mountain College) in Blue Mountain is a private Baptist institution. U.S. News & World Report recognizes it as a best-value southern regional college and a top school for advancing social mobility for students.
Its Bachelor of Science in psychology degree is one of the few online psychology programs in Mississippi that integrates the Christian faith.
It requires 120 credits and costs $528 per credit plus fees.
Other Online Colleges
The following accredited schools also offer online bachelor's degrees in psychology for Mississippi residents.
Purdue Global
Purdue Global in West Lafayette, IN, offers online bachelor's degrees in psychology in different areas, including:
- Bachelor of Science in psychology
- Bachelor of Science in psychology in addictions
- Bachelor of Science in psychology in applied behavior analysis
- Bachelor of Science in industrial and organizational psychology
All programs require 180 credits to graduate. The cost is $371 per credit plus fees. Military tuition assistance is available to those who qualify.
University of Phoenix
The University of Phoenix in Arizona delivers classes primarily through virtual learning. Its online psychology program offers degrees in the following areas:
- Bachelor of Science in applied psychology with a concentration in media and technology
- Bachelor of Science in industrial and organizational psychology
A total of 120 credits is needed to earn a bachelor's degree. It costs $398 per credit plus fees and typically takes four years to complete.
Southern New Hampshire University
Southern New Hampshire University in Manchester offers several online Bachelor of Arts in psychology degrees where students can choose from the following concentrations:
- addictions
- applied psychology
- child and adolescent development
- forensic psychology
- mental health
- social psychology
Students also earn an embedded 12-credit psychology credential in data literacy when enrolled in this program.
A total of 120 credits is required, and the cost is $320 per credit plus fees. Students can transfer up to 90 credits.
Walden University
Walden University is in Minneapolis, MN. It offers several online Bachelor of Science in psychology degrees in the following concentrations:
- child and adolescent development
- addiction
- criminal justice
- forensic psychology
- general psychology
- human services
- workplace psychology
In addition, it offers an accelerated online Bachelor of Science in psychology option where students can enroll in up to five master's level courses and pay the undergraduate tuition rate.
It costs $333 per credit plus fees and requires 182 credits to graduate.
Liberty University
Located in Lynchburg, VA, Liberty University provides online Bachelor of Science in psychology programs with concentration options that include:
- addictions and recovery
- Christian counseling
- criminal psychology
- crisis counseling
- developmental psychology
- general psychology
- life coaching
- military resilience
Its psychology programs require 120 credits to graduate and take an average of three and a half years to complete.
It costs $390 per credit plus fees. In addition, military members and their families receive a discount of $250 per credit plus fees.

What Are the Average Salaries for Psychology Graduates in Mississippi?
Psychologists in Mississippi earn an annual salary of $71,700 per the Occupational Employment and Wage Statistics of the United States Bureau of Labor Statistics.
School psychologists make an annual mean wage of $61,460, and postsecondary psychology teachers make $64,640. Counseling and clinical psychologists earn $76,460.

What Field of Psychology Is the Most Popular in Mississippi?
The most popular field of psychology in Mississippi is clinical psychology. This field focuses on the diagnosis and treatment of mental disorders.
Another well-known field of psychology in Mississippi is counseling psychology, which concentrates on helping people cope with personal, emotional, and social issues.
Also in demand are school psychologists who assess and address children and adolescents' educational and social needs.
